The cheapest way to get from Rome to Pigeon Forge is to drive which costs $140 - $220 and takes 14h 15m.
The fastest way to get from Rome to Pigeon Forge is to train and fly and taxi which takes 8h 6m and costs $330 - $1,300.
The distance between Rome and Pigeon Forge is 739 miles. The road distance is 807.2 miles.
The best way to get from Rome to Pigeon Forge without a car is to train and bus and taxi which takes 19h 22m and costs $330 - $480.
It takes approximately 8h 6m to get from Rome to Pigeon Forge,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Rome to Pigeon Forge is 807 miles. It takes approximately 14h 15m to drive from Rome to Pigeon Forge.
